The San Diego Padres defeated the Cleveland Guardians 5-0 on August 16, 2026, at Progressive Field, using power and steady pitching to control the game. San Diego collected 10 hits, including four home runs, and all five of its runs were credited as RBI, reflecting an offense that converted its biggest swings into production rather than relying on Cleveland mistakes. The Guardians finished with only three hits and did not commit an error, so the decisive margin came from the Padres’ advantage at the plate and their ability to suppress Cleveland’s lineup. San Diego’s pitching staff worked around limited traffic and completed the shutout, while Cleveland’s pitchers struggled to keep the ball in the park despite otherwise avoiding defensive complications. With no Vegas total available, the clearest trend was pitching dominance on one side: the Padres prevented Cleveland from scoring while their offense generated most of its damage through the long ball.
